Linux 完全静态libcurl构建

Linux 完全静态libcurl构建,linux,curl,static,hyperlink,compilation,Linux,Curl,Static,Hyperlink,Compilation,我正在linux上构建一个依赖libcurl的程序。我希望它可以在不需要任何外部依赖的情况下进行分发和运行。libcurl似乎有很多这样的。。。因此,我想知道是否有任何方法可以静态编译libcurl以包含其所有依赖项 或者,是否已经存在它的预构建版本?我认为人们喜欢从源代码构建的主要原因是因为他们知道,假设编译器没有后门,这将非常复杂,无论如何,要实现它,他们必须得到源代码所说的,而不是其他东西。这也是您签署源代码包的原因,即curl网站上相应下载链接之后的gpg链接。。。基本上你真的不想这么做

我正在linux上构建一个依赖libcurl的程序。我希望它可以在不需要任何外部依赖的情况下进行分发和运行。libcurl似乎有很多这样的。。。因此,我想知道是否有任何方法可以静态编译libcurl以包含其所有依赖项


或者,是否已经存在它的预构建版本?

我认为人们喜欢从源代码构建的主要原因是因为他们知道,假设编译器没有后门,这将非常复杂,无论如何,要实现它,他们必须得到源代码所说的,而不是其他东西。这也是您签署源代码包的原因,即curl网站上相应下载链接之后的gpg链接。。。基本上你真的不想这么做。特别是考虑到Linux上构建与Windows不同的东西是多么微不足道,Windows通常没有为初学者安装工具链。我认为人们喜欢从源代码构建的主要原因是因为他们知道假设编译器没有后门,这将是非常复杂的实现无论如何,他们得到的消息来源说,而不是其他东西。这也是您签署源代码包的原因,即curl网站上相应下载链接之后的gpg链接。。。基本上你真的不想这么做。特别是考虑到在Linux上构建一些与Windows不同的东西是多么微不足道,Windows通常没有为初学者安装工具链。